Backlash to 'lazy stereotypes' in women's rugby article builds

Railway Union RFC said they “are disappointed that what could have been a hugely positive article promoting women's rugby in Ireland at time of such achievement internationally has been reduced to stereotyping.”

The club explained that they were asked “by the IRFU to facilitate a journalist from the Sunday Independent who wanted to do a training session and a feature on women's rugby in light of Ireland's world cup heroics.”
